You are on page 1of 1

Prior reading on the following will enhance the learning environment and understanding of the subject.

Hence, students are advised doing a revisinon of foundational database management system and
concepts. This includes but is not limited to:

1. File based approaches VS database systems


2. Database systems
2.1. Relations
2.2. Attributes
2.2.1.Key attributes and foreign keys
2.3. Tuples or records
2.4. Relationships
2.5. Integrity constraints
2.5.1.Primary key constraints
2.5.2.Referential integrity constraints
2.5.3.Functional dependency
3. Normalization and Normal Forms
4. Data definition languages and data manipulation languages
4.1. Structured Query language (SQL)
5. Relational algebra and relational calculus

You might also like